Metal Additive–Free Iodine–Promoted Reorganization of Ynamide-Ynes and Stereoselective 1,2-Diiodination
We report a metal additive–free iodine-promoted one-step structural reorganization of ynamide-ynes and simultaneous stereoselective 1,2-diiodination of the migrated alkyne to form stereospecific tetrasubstituted alkenyl diiodo-tethered indoles (E-isomer). Molecular iodine is cost effective, user friendly, less toxic, commercially available, and easy to handle. The key features of the reaction include metal–and additive–free environment, selectivity, structural reorganization, mild reaction conditions, simple workup, and gram-scale synthesis. This transformation generates multiple bonds [nitrogen (N)-carbon (C)sp2, Csp2−Csp2, 2 Csp2-iodine (I)] via N−Csp bond cleavage in ynamide-ynes.

Chemistry—An Asian Journal is an international high-impact journal for chemistry in its broadest sense. The journal covers all aspects of chemistry from biochemistry through organic and inorganic chemistry to physical chemistry, including interdisciplinary topics.
Chemistry—An Asian Journal publishes Full Papers, Communications, and Focus Reviews.
A professional editorial team headed by Dr. Theresa Kueckmann and an Editorial Board (headed by Professor Susumu Kitagawa) ensure the highest quality of the peer-review process, the contents and the production of the journal.
Chemistry—An Asian Journal is published on behalf of the Asian Chemical Editorial Society (ACES), an association of numerous Asian chemical societies, and supported by the Gesellschaft Deutscher Chemiker (GDCh, German Chemical Society), ChemPubSoc Europe, and the Federation of Asian Chemical Societies (FACS).
